Einzelnen Beitrag anzeigen
  #1  
Alt 07.06.2013, 12:23:34
sysop sysop ist offline
Member
 
Registriert seit: Mar 2004
Ort: wien
Beiträge: 512
wget mit Kontrolle ob alles komplett geladen wurde

Ich möchte regelmässig mit einem PHP-Script eine Zip-Datei per wget herunterladen, die Datei kann unterschiedliche Grössen haben. Die Datei wird dann entpackt und weiter verarbeitet.

Nun möchte ich sicher sein, dass die Datei komplett geladen ist, bevor ich den nächsten Schritt mache, da steckt mein Problem!
wget generiert ja keine wirkliche Ausgabe und mit passthru($cmd) bekomme ich keine Anzeige.

Eine spontane andere Idee wäre:
Zuerst die md5 Prüfsumme zu laden und mit dem Download zu vergleichen, erst bei Gleichheit nächster Schritt. Das gefällt mir aber nicht, da ich ja praktisch in einer Schleife die Prüfsumme errechnen müsste.

Kennt jemand eine vernünftige Möglichkeit die Vollständigkeit eines Downloads zu prüfen um im Script weiter machen zu können, also die weitere Verarbeitung zu starten?
__________________
Gruss sys ;-)
Ich möchte wie mein Grossvater sterben, lächelnd und schlafend, nicht schreiend und weinend, wie sein Beifahrer.
Mit Zitat antworten